D.C. Area Teach Truth Day of Action

  • African American Civil War Memorial 1925 Vermont Avenue Northwest Washington, DC, 20001 United States (map)

This Teach Truth Day of Action is hosted by the African American Civil War Memorial and Museum and D.C. Area Educators for Social Justice. It is one of many Teach Truth Day of Action events being held across the United States at historic sites.

This event uplifts the voices that are censored by the increasing number of anti-history education laws. Everybody is invited to be in solidarity with D.C. area educators and students as they provide a valuable counter-narrative to the oversized coverage of anti-CRT protests at school board meetings and attacks against LGBTQ+ and trans rights.
